Autonomous Learning in Online and Traditional Versions of a Software Engineering Course

This paper reports on a comparison of student opinion of student-defined projects and self-grading strategies between students in online and face-to-face environments as part of an ongoing survey-based study into strategies that support autonomous learning. The course used in the study is a Web Application Design and Development course which is part of the Software Engineering certificate and software concentration in the MSCS at Rensselaer (RPI) at Hartford. The study has been underway since the fall of 2001 and has an audience of working professional students. During the spring 2004 semester, the course was offered in both an online and a face-to-face format with roughly equivalent numbers of students in both sections. Students were surveyed towards the beginning and at the end of the semester on their opinions of the approaches used in the course and of their learning. This paper presents some background in autonomous or self-directed learning, describes the study including the approach and environment, and discusses results of student surveys comparing results for online and face-to-face students.
